Wound Care RN (Part-Time, Day, 24)

RESPONSIBILITIESI. JOB SUMMARY/RESPONSIBILITIES: Provides clinical consultation to Patient Care Team to facilitate coordination of wound care across the continuum for wound center patients. For patients admitted to the inpatient setting, the Wound Care Registered Nurse provides a report to the inpatient wound nurse regarding wound center treatment plan, wound healing progress and long-range goals.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to, managing a caseload of wound center patients, thorough assessment, patient/family education and advocacy, treatment planning, resource management and discharge planning.IV.TYPICAL PHYSICAL DEMANDS: Essential: lifting up to 5-10 lb., seeing, hearing, talking, grasping, fingering. Continuous: standing, walking, stooping, forward reaching, handling. Frequent: pushing and pulling up to 30 psi, lifting up to 10 lbs., sitting, bending, squatting, twisting. Occasional: pushing and pulling up to 70 psi; lifting: horizontal lift/carry up to 75 lbs. with assistance, floor to waist up to 35 lbs., waist to shoulder up to 25 lbs., overhead level up to 15 lbs.; carrying up to 35 lbs, running, climbing, side bending, kneeling, crouching, overhead reaching. Operates various machines/tools/work aids.III. TYPICAL WORKING CONDITIONS: May be exposed to body fluids, blood products, and communicable diseases. Work environment may be highly stressful, fast paced and hectic. May be subjected to patients with behavior health conditions. May be subjected to heavy patients requiring transfer to and from wound center chair or table.IV.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:A. EDUCATION/CERTIFICATION AND LICENSURE: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Nursing. Current Hawaii State License as a Registered Nurse. Current certification in one (1) of the following wound certifications strongly preferred:o Wound, Ostomy and Continence Nursing Certification Board (WOCNCB): Certified Wound, Ostomy and Continence Nurse (CWOCN) Certified Wound Ostomy Nurse (CWON) Certified Wound Care Nurse (CWCN)o American Board of Wound Management (ABWM): Certified Wound Specialist (CWS)o National Alliance of Wound Care and Ostomy (NAWCO): Wound Care Certified (WCC) Current certification in Basic Life Support at the Healthcare Professional Level.B. EXPERIENCE: Two (2) years clinical nursing experience.Equal Opportunity Employer/Disability/Vet
